Marks and Spencer (or M&S) is a British multinational retailer that sells clothing and food, furniture and home appliances and beauty products. It has over 703 stores in the United Kingdom and abroad, and employs approximately 138,000 people across the globe. The company's headquarters are in London, England. The company's beginnings were in 1884 when Jewish refugee Michael Marks opened a stall in an open market in Leeds. The sign on the stall read: "Don't Ask the Price - It's a Penny". After the business was successful, Marks decided to seek partners and invited Thomas Spencer to join him. Spencer invested 300 pounds and brought a wealth of skills in accounting and management in addition to Marks ability to sell products and selling.

M&S stores were built in the early days to adapt to changing social circumstances. Marks adapted to the changing social environment by using open displays, which encouraged browsing and self selection. The company's growth was rapid during this period, with 145 stores by 1915.

In the 1960s, M&S started to develop its own brand of products. This included the introduction of synthetic fibres like Tricell and Coutelle, and machine washable woollens. Lingerie was given a fashion 'edge' in the 1980s with coordinated sets that were based on catwalk trends.

M&S is committed to reducing its environmental footprint. It has developed a 100-point plan that affects every aspect of its business, from heating in the store to product labels. The goal is to cut down on emissions, promoting healthy eating and fair partnerships and utilizing sustainable raw materials.

Hennes & Mauritz AB, founded in 1947 is the second-largest fashion retailer in the world. Its success is based on fast fashion. This means identifying trends and getting cheap copies into stores as soon as it is possible. H&M unlike other retailers who take months to design and create new styles, H&M can create a collection in only two weeks. H&M's stores are always stocked with new clothing.

H&M in addition to its extensive range of products and services, is also known for its social responsibility initiatives. The company has committed to minimize its environmental impact and pay workers an income that is sustainable by 2030. It also supports a clothing collection program that allows customers to donate their used clothing.
